Isolated oculomotor nerve palsy due to mesencephalic infarction diagnosed by ZOOM DWI
Abstract Background Oculomotor nerve palsy is a common neurological presentation in daily practice. Case presentation A 55-year-old man presented with a 3-h history of diplopia and drooping of his bilateral especially left eyelids.
